数据库集群的一个坏处是什么,数据库集群作用 (解决方法与步骤)
下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。
2023-08-31 15:47 82
数据库集群的一个坏处是难以维护和管理。在数据库集群中,由于涉及到多个节点和服务器的操作和维护,会增加管理员的工作量和复杂性,对技术人员的要求也相应提高。因为需要对集群进行监控、性能调优、故障排查等操作,这要求管理员具备深入的数据库知识和经验。如果集群中的某个节点出现故障,需要及时进行修复和恢复,以保证整个集群的可用性和性能。
举例说明,某公司的在线电商平台使用了数据库集群来存储和管理用户的交易数据,但由于集群节点过多,管理和维护起来非常困难。每当有新的需求或者故障发生时,管理员需要花费大量的时间和精力来进行处理,导致平台的运营效率和用户体验受到影响。由于技术人员的要求较高,很难找到合适的专业人才来处理集群的维护工作,从而加大了公司的人力成本和风险。
针对数据库集群难以维护和管理的问题,有以下几点解决方案: 1. 自动化运维:通过使用自动化工具来简化和自动化集群的维护和管理过程,减轻管理员的工作负担。例如,可以使用监控工具来实时监测集群的状态和性能,以便及时发现和解决问题。 2. 定期维护和更新:定期进行数据库集群的维护和更新,包括软件版本的升级、安全补丁的安装和配置优化等。这样可以保证集群的性能和稳定性,并减少故障的发生概率。 3. 培训和知识分享:加强技术人员的培训和知识分享,提高其对集群维护和管理的能力。可以组织培训课程、分享会等形式,让技术人员可以学习和交流集群管理的经验和技巧。
案例解析:某互联网公司使用了数据库集群来存储和管理用户的大量数据,但由于集群的复杂性和管理困难,经常出现性能瓶颈和故障问题。为了解决这个问题,公司采取了自动化运维的方案,引入了监控工具和自动调优系统,实现了对数据库集群的自动监控和性能调整。通过定期维护和更新,以及技术人员的培训和知识分享,公司成功提高了数据库集群的稳定性和性能,提升了用户的满意度和公司的竞争力。
FAQ: 1. 数据库集群管理是否需要专业的技术人员? 是的,数据库集群的管理需要具备深入的数据库知识和经验的技术人员来进行操作和维护。 2. 数据库集群会增加企业的成本吗? 是的,引入数据库集群会增加硬件、软件和人力成本,但可以提高系统的可靠性和性能。 3. 数据库集群有哪些优点? 数据库集群可以提高系统的可用性、可靠性和性能,实现数据的分布式存储和并行处理。 4. 如何快速排查数据库集群的故障? 可以通过监控工具来实时监测集群的状态和性能,快速发现和解决故障问题。 5. 数据库集群是否适用于所有企业? 不是,数据库集群适用于需要处理大量数据和具有高可用性需求的企业。对于规模较小的企业,使用单节点数据库可能更加合适。